  • The Little Poppy who Learned to Remember (US Edition)

    by Carl Gincley ...
    Illustrated by Julia Seal ...
    Little Shirley Poppy has a paper to write for her teacher about Memorial Day and the importance of red poppies. This has special meaning for Shirley because she is a red poppy flower. She asks her grandparents to help with the essay and the creation of a new poppy lapel pin. This story is a gentle discovery of how poppies are honored to serve as companions to people in observing remembrance. It is ... Read more
